10// UNSUPPORTED: c++98, c++03
11
12// <experimental/memory_resource>
13
14// template <class T> class polymorphic_allocator
15
16// template <class U>
17// polymorphic_allocator<T>::polymorphic_allocator(polymorphic_allocator<U> const &);
18
19
20#include <experimental/memory_resource>
21#include <type_traits>
22#include <cassert>
23
24namespace ex = std::experimental::pmr;
25
26int main()
27{
28 typedef ex::polymorphic_allocator<void> A1;
29 typedef ex::polymorphic_allocator<char> A2;
30 { // Test that the conversion is implicit and noexcept.
31 static_assert(
32 std::is_convertible<A1 const &, A2>::value, ""
33 );
34 static_assert(
35 std::is_convertible<A2 const &, A1>::value, ""
36 );
37 static_assert(
38 std::is_nothrow_constructible<A1, A2 const &>::value, ""
39 );
40 static_assert(
41 std::is_nothrow_constructible<A2, A1 const &>::value, ""
42 );
43 }
44 // copy other type
45 {
46 A1 const a((ex::memory_resource*)42);
47 A2 const a2(a);
48 assert(a.resource() == a2.resource());
49 assert(a2.resource() == (ex::memory_resource*)42);
50 }
51 {
52 A1 a((ex::memory_resource*)42);
53 A2 const a2(std::move(a));
54 assert(a.resource() == a2.resource());
55 assert(a2.resource() == (ex::memory_resource*)42);
56 }
57}
